Markham is a south suburb of Chicago located in Cook County, Illinois, with a population of 11,661 according to the 2020 census. The area has deep historical roots, with evidence suggesting it was once a beach ten thousand years ago before transforming into prairies dotted with groves of trees and abundant wildlife. In 1816, a treaty with the Ottawa, Chippewa, and Potawatomi tribes opened the region to settlers, establishing an Indian boundary line that still appears on government maps today and even intersects with Interstate 57 near Markham.
The village of Markham was officially incorporated in 1925 with fewer than three hundred residents and was named for Charles H. Markham, president of the Illinois Central Railroad. Growth accelerated in the mid-1930s when the Croissant Park subdivision was developed, and the population surged after World War II, doubling to 2,753 by 1950. Markham evolved into a bedroom community as residents prioritized homes over industry. The city was formally incorporated on August 24, 1967.
A unique piece of Markham's heritage is the Lone Pine Tree, adopted as the official city symbol in 1985. In 1860, a German immigrant named Lawrence Roesner planted six seedlings from Germany's Black Forest along the Indian Boundary Line. Though the original lone survivor died in 1986, the Markham Garden Club planted a replacement tree from the Black Forest that same year. Today, Markham encompasses approximately 500 acres of virgin and restored prairie land, including the Gensburg-Markham Prairie, designated a National Natural Landmark.
